
Washington, April 3 (RHC)-- U.S. President Donald Trump is reportedly considering a deal that would avert a ban on TikTok by allowing the Chinese parent company ByteDance to keep control of the app’s algorithm but lease it to a new U.S. spinoff entity.
Lawmakers have claimed TikTok poses a national security concern, but critics of the ban say it’s motivated by anti-Chinese bias and is a threat to free speech and some users’ livelihoods.
The pause on the ban expires on Saturday. Amazon also made a late bid to buy TikTok, though some reports say it’s been rejected by Trump officials.
